Sample #2 sounds most balanced in terms of volume and presence. In #1 and #3 the violins appear significantly more distant than viola and cello, and I hear the troublesome room.
I'd try to use #2 with some nice reverb tail added (feed the reverb pre-fader from spots).

If DIN and omnis are "completely out of phase" maybe one pair has inverted polarity outputs.
